Calligraphy is not only an art form and a symbol of Japanese culture, but also a form of meditation. Guided by a professional calligraphy instructor, you’ll use handmade brushes from Kumano, Hiroshima — Japan’s top brush-making town — and enjoy a calm, creative moment to express yourself. Write your own calligraphy on a fan or shikishi and take home a unique souvenir. The workshop is held at “Takumi,” a 50-year-old folk craft shop. One wall is beautifully decorated with ukiyo-e prints, creating an artistic atmosphere. “Takumi” is also known as Hiroshima’s leading craft shop, offering traditional items from across Japan.
